Our Program

The Adopt A Senior program provides a wonderful opportunity for our next generation of leaders to build relationships with senior citizens in their communities. It is an amazing program that provides tangible benefits to both the seniors and the student volunteers who participate in the program. Students who have a heart for serving their communities are often eager to participate and build relationships with senior citizens who so often can feel lost, forgotten or simply lonely. And, an amazing thing happens in the process of creating those relationships. The students who participate as a way of "giving back" often find themselves the recipients of an equal amount of love, while they too experience a tremendous amount of intergenerational learning.

Programs can be customized to meet the needs of the Senior Living Centers and the participating senior citizens.

Current program examples include:

- Students teaching seniors about email, video chat and various social media applications

- Students hosting activities at the senior living centers

- Ongoing sharing of stories and life experiences from different generations

- Periodic in person visits

- Establishing a "Digital Pen Pal" experience for seniors allowing them to exchange emails and send text messages to the volunteers

- Establishing a video chat routine to build ongoing connections
